Java(JDK/Tomcat/Maven)运行环境配置及工具(idea/eclipse)安装详细教程

下面是Java运行环境配置及工具安装的详细教程,包括JDK、Tomcat、Maven以及IDE(idea和eclipse)的安装和配置。

一、安装JDK

1.下载JDK安装包

你可以在Oracle官网下载适用于你的操作系统的JDK安装包,也可以到JDK官网下载。下载时要注意区分JDK的版本和平台,一般建议选择稳定版本(如JDK8)。

2.安装JDK

运行下载好的JDK安装程序,按照提示操作即可。注意选择正确的安装路径,可以把JDK安装到自定义目录。

3.配置环境变量

安装完成后,需要配置环境变量,以便系统可以找到JDK。在系统环境变量中设置JAVA_HOME和Path两个变量,JAVA_HOME指向JDK的安装路径,Path需要包含JDK的bin目录。

举个例子(假设JDK安装目录为C:\Program Files\Java\jdk1.8.0_191):

JAVA_HOME=C:\Program Files\Java\jdk1.8.0_191
Path=%PATH%;%JAVA_HOME%\bin

4.验证JDK是否安装成功

在命令行输入java -versionjavac -version,如果能够正常输出版本号,则说明JDK安装成功。

二、安装Tomcat

1.下载Tomcat安装包

可以在Tomcat官网下载适用于你的操作系统的Tomcat安装包,也可以从其他镜像网站下载。

2.解压Tomcat安装包

将下载好的Tomcat安装包解压到自定义目录,比如D:\Tomcat。

3.配置Tomcat

运行Tomcat,在浏览器输入http://localhost:8080,如果能够正常访问Tomcat欢迎页,说明安装成功。

4.部署Web应用程序

在Tomcat安装目录下的webapps目录中,创建一个新目录,比如demo,在该目录下放置一个index.html文件,然后运行Tomcat,访问http://localhost:8080/demo/index.html,如果能够正常显示index.html页面,则说明Web应用程序部署成功。

三、安装Maven

1.下载Maven安装包

你可以在Maven官网下载适用于你的操作系统的Maven安装包。

2.安装Maven

运行下载好的Maven安装程序,按照提示操作即可。安装完成后,需要配置环境变量。

3.配置环境变量

在系统环境变量中设置MAVEN_HOME和Path两个变量,MAVEN_HOME指向Maven的安装路径,Path需要包含Maven的bin目录。

举个例子(假设Maven安装目录为C:\apache-maven-3.6.3):

MAVEN_HOME=C:\apache-maven-3.6.3
Path=%PATH%;%MAVEN_HOME%\bin

4.验证Maven是否安装成功

在命令行输入mvn -version,如果能够正常输出Maven的版本号,则说明Maven安装成功。

四、安装IDE

1.下载IDE

可以在IDE官网下载适用于你的操作系统的IDE安装包。

2.安装IDE

运行下载好的IDE安装程序,按照提示操作即可。IDE的安装过程比较简单,这里不再赘述。

3.配置IDE

安装完成后,需要配置IDE,比如配置Tomcat的运行环境、配置Maven的本地仓库等。

4.使用IDE

配置完成后,就可以使用IDE进行开发了。比如可以新建一个Java项目,增加一个Servlet类,然后通过Tomcat运行该项目并访问Servlet提供的服务。

例子1:使用IDE开发Java Web应用程序

以下是使用IDE开发Java Web应用程序的示例:

  1. 新建一个Java项目,选择Web Application类型;
  2. 在项目中增加一个Servlet类;
  3. 配置Tomcat的运行环境,指定Tomcat的安装路径和端口号;
  4. 配置Maven的本地仓库,指定Maven在本地存储依赖库的路径;
  5. 在项目的pom.xml文件中增加依赖,比如Spring MVC和JDBC依赖;
  6. 使用IDE的工具进行开发,比如写Servlet类、JSP页面、配置Spring MVC等;
  7. 运行项目,在浏览器中查看效果。

例子2:使用Maven构建Java项目

以下是使用Maven构建Java项目的示例:

  1. 新建一个Java项目,使用Maven方式创建;
  2. 在项目的pom.xml文件中增加依赖和配置,比如Spring、MyBatis等;
  3. 使用IDE的工具进行开发,比如写Java代码、配置Spring容器、编写测试用例;
  4. 使用Maven的命令行工具对项目进行构建,比如使用mvn clean package命令打包项目;
  5. 将生成的目标文件放置到Tomcat的webapps目录下,启动Tomcat运行项目;
  6. 在浏览器中查看效果。

以上就是Java(JDK/Tomcat/Maven)运行环境配置及工具(idea/eclipse)安装详细教程的完整攻略,希望可以帮助到你。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Java(JDK/Tomcat/Maven)运行环境配置及工具(idea/eclipse)安装详细教程 - Python技术站

(0)
上一篇 2023年5月19日
下一篇 2023年5月19日

相关文章

  • java基础教程之拼图游戏的实现

    Java 基础教程之拼图游戏的实现 1. 游戏介绍 拼图是一种经典的益智游戏,目的是将图片划分成若干个小块并打乱排列,然后将其重新组合成完整的图片。在这个项目中,我们将使用 Java 语言实现一个简单的拼图游戏,涉及的主要知识点包括 Java Swing 及基本的面向对象编程。 2. 实现步骤 2.1 项目初始化 首先,我们需要创建一个 Java 项目,并添…

    Java 2023年5月20日
    00
  • 关于Maven依赖冲突解决之exclusions

    Maven是一种非常流行的构建工具,可以用来自动化构建、打包和管理Java项目中所需的依赖关系。但由于不同的依赖可能会有冲突,因此Maven提供了一种“exclusions”机制来解决这个问题。 1. 什么是exclusions 当一个项目依赖的其他项目中存在相同的依赖时,就可能会发生依赖冲突。例如,项目A依赖了项目B和项目C,而项目B和项目C都依赖了同一个…

    Java 2023年5月19日
    00
  • java.lang.ExceptionInInitializerError异常的解决方法

    当在Java应用程序中使用静态代码块或静态变量时,可能会出现java.lang.ExceptionInInitializerError异常。该异常是由于在静态代码块或静态变量赋值期间抛出异常而导致的。 在解决此异常的过程中,需要扫描静态块或静态变量的代码,找出其中可能引起错误的部分,并对其进行调试修复。 以下是解决java.lang.ExceptionInI…

    Java 2023年5月27日
    00
  • JSP实现弹出登陆框以及阴影效果

    要实现JSP弹出登录框和阴影效果,需要分为以下几个步骤: 步骤一:创建HTML页面 首先,我们需要创建一个HTML页面,该页面包含两个部分:登录界面和遮罩层。登录部分包括用户名、密码、登录和取消按钮,遮罩层可以防止用户在操作登录界面之外的内容。 HTML代码如下所示: <!DOCTYPE html> <html> <head&g…

    Java 2023年6月15日
    00
  • Java如何实现支付宝电脑支付基于servlet版本

    Java 如何实现支付宝电脑支付基于 Servlet 版本,具体的实现步骤如下: 1. 注册支付宝商家账号 首先需要注册一个支付宝商家账号。 2. 下载支付宝开发者工具包 下载支付宝提供的开发者工具包,官方推荐使用 Java 版本的 SDK。 3. 创建订单 在进行支付前需要创建一个订单,在创建订单时需要填写订单的一些基本信息,例如订单金额、商品名称、订单号…

    Java 2023年5月26日
    00
  • Java中Stream流去除List重复元素的方法

    首先要说明一下,Java中的Stream流是Java8中新增的一种函数式操作流程,主要用来对集合进行函数式操作,它可以对集合进行一些链式操作,比如筛选、分组、排序、去重等。 List去重,在Java8中,可以借助Stream流,具体步骤如下: 使用Stream.builder()来构造一个Stream.Builder对象; 通过builder对象调用add方…

    Java 2023年5月31日
    00
  • java实现接口的典型案例

    Java使用接口来定义接口规范和实现类之间的约定。接口指定的方法是在实现类中要实现的。下面是Java实现接口的典型案例的完整攻略。 1. 定义接口 首先,在Java中定义接口使用interface关键字。接口定义了一堆方法,但是不会实现这些方法。下面的截图是一个简单的MyInterface接口的例子。 public interface MyInterface…

    Java 2023年5月18日
    00
  • 深入理解Java中的构造函数引用和方法引用

    深入理解Java中的构造函数引用和方法引用 在Java中,构造函数引用和方法引用是两个很重要的概念。了解这两个概念可以帮助Java程序员更好地编写代码,提高代码的质量和可读性。 构造函数引用 构造函数引用可以用来创建对象。在Java 8之前,我们通常使用匿名内部类来创建对象。例如: Runnable runnable = new Runnable() { @…

    Java 2023年5月26日
    00
合作推广
合作推广
分享本页
返回顶部